Farmers and ranchers oftentimes resort to poisoning or shooting animals they classify as varmints that threaten their crops or livestock.  Unless the varmint population has increased from consuming crops or livestock, they are integral to a balanced ecosystem.  Therefore, killing varmints that don't rely on crops or livestock creates ecosystem imbalance.  Ranchers are allowed to roam their livestock, and of course predators prey on the livestock. Ranchers are allowed to kill predators that threaten their livestock and kill burrowing animals whose holes may injure the legs of livestock when they step in the holes.

Do permaculture farming and livestock rearing methods reduce or eliminate damage to crops or livestock from wild mammals?  Thank for any replies.
